Overview
The D+H GVL 8408-M is a 24 V DC natural ventilation control panel for medium window automation applications. It is suited to projects where multiple windows or louvres are operated as grouped natural ventilation zones using local controls, external control signals, room temperature control and optional wind/rain sensor protection.

At-a-glance
| Application | Natural ventilation |
|---|---|
| Panel output | 24 V DC / 8 A total drive current |
| Ventilation groups | 5 as standard, can be expanded to 6 with an optional GME83 plug in card |
| Fire zones / lines | Not applicable — GVL series panels are for natural ventilation only |
| Control inputs | Wall switch / external control / room temperature control / wind-rain sensor |
| Housing | GEH-KST sold separately, plastic with sheet metal door |
| Dimensions (WxHxD) | 310 x 310 x 100 mm of GEH-KST housing |
| Manufacturer | D+H Mechatronic |

Technical notes for specifiers
- This is a natural ventilation control panel.
- It is not intended as a smoke control panel and does not include a dedicated fire input or failsafe battery backup operation.
- The GVL series does not provide automatic close on loss of power. If this function is required, consider a D+H RZN or custom CPS-M panel.
- Confirm total actuator current before selection.
- Confirm the number of windows, actuator type, control groups and group plug-in unit requirements.
- Confirm weather sensor, room temperature control and local control requirements.
- Confirm whether BMS or other third-party controls are required.

About CPS-M: EBSA CPS-M panels are custom designed as project-specific control solutions using D+H modular components. The process begins by establishing the project scope, control philosophy and functional requirements, which are then developed into shop drawings and wiring schematics. Once approved, the panel is built by EBSA to suit the agreed design and control logic.
